Output 786790ed3c0360cb4758a692a8e04e7f9d6e83f27860501455d8880fdb81db9d:2

value
23901716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56f43b002f0a8bca30821f002a9d502222e7443 OP_EQUAL
address
3M9Z9ByN9YbDafGxcbxDt7iNrvXfaUQQfF
transaction
786790ed3c0360cb4758a692a8e04e7f9d6e83f27860501455d8880fdb81db9d
spent
true